在AngularJS中显示HTML内容值可以通过使用ng-bind-html指令来实现。ng-bind-html指令用于将HTML内容绑定到指定的元素上。
首先,确保你已经引入了AngularJS库文件。然后,在你的HTML文件中,使用ng-bind-html指令来绑定HTML内容值。
例如,假设你有一个控制器和一个包含HTML内容的变量:
<div ng-controller="myController">
<div ng-bind-html="htmlContent"></div>
</div>
在控制器中,你需要使用$sce服务来标记HTML内容为可信任的,以避免安全风险。$sce服务用于处理AngularJS中的安全上下文。
app.controller('myController', function($scope, $sce) {
$scope.htmlContent = $sce.trustAsHtml('<h1>Hello, AngularJS!</h1>');
});
在上面的例子中,我们使用了$sce.trustAsHtml方法来标记HTML内容为可信任的。这样,AngularJS就会将HTML内容作为实际的HTML代码进行解析,并在页面上显示出来。
需要注意的是,为了使用ng-bind-html指令,你需要在模块中注入ngSanitize模块。ngSanitize模块提供了对HTML内容的安全处理。
var app = angular.module('myApp', ['ngSanitize']);
推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云对象存储(COS)。
请注意,以上只是腾讯云的一些产品示例,其他云计算品牌商也提供类似的产品和服务。
AngularJS HTML DOM
AngularJS为HTML DOM 元素的属性提供了绑定应用数据的指令。
ng-disabled指令
ng-disabled指令直接绑定应用数据到HTML的disabled属性。
实例:
<button ng-disableled="mySwitch">点我!</button
领取专属 10元无门槛券
手把手带您无忧上云